About HASH

HASH is building an open-source platform for structured knowledge and organizational decision-making. We turn information from databases, applications, documents, communications, sensors, and other sources into continuously updated knowledge and process graphs. From this shared model, organizations can analyze their operations, simulate possible futures, automate workflows, and give AI agents the context they need to act reliably.

Our mission is to solve information failure and enable everybody to make the right decisions. We work on difficult technical and commercial problems, including applications in regulated and safety-critical environments.

About the role

HASH has no shortage of substance to communicate: open-source infrastructure, frontier AI research, visual products, real enterprise problems and a clear point of view about how AI should reason over a changing world. We’re hiring a Marketing & Communications Lead to turn that substance into a coherent system that reaches the right people and gives them useful reasons to keep engaging with us.

You will own content, lifecycle email, newsletters, social channels, SEO, website marketing copy and marketing operations. You’ll decide what we should communicate, to whom, in what form and why. You’ll write and edit much of the work yourself, draw expertise from researchers, engineers and customer-facing colleagues, brief our brand designers, automate distribution and measure what the audience does next.

This is a senior, hands-on individual-contributor role. It is not a job for someone who wants to write a strategy and delegate execution to a large team. You will build the function while operating it.

Requirements

  • Exceptional writing and editing, with a portfolio that makes complicated ideas feel clear, specific and important
  • Hands-on ownership of several of lifecycle email, newsletters, technical content, social distribution, SEO, product marketing or marketing operations
  • The ability to build automated journeys, segments and measurement yourself rather than waiting for a dedicated operations team
  • Strong editorial judgment and a clear understanding of the difference between material that earns attention and content produced to fill a calendar
  • Commercial awareness without the instinct to make every communication sound like an advertisement
  • The ability to learn unfamiliar technical subjects, identify the real idea and preserve accuracy while improving the explanation
  • Thoughtful use of AI and automation for leverage, while retaining responsibility for every published claim
  • High agency and the ability to sustain a demanding cadence without sacrificing quality

Experience with enterprise AI, data infrastructure, developer tools, simulation, analytics or another technical B2B product is useful. So is experience building an early-stage marketing function and communicating to multiple members of an enterprise buying committee. Excellent written and spoken English is essential.

What you'll do

  • Develop a clear positioning and message system for technical, operational and executive audiences
  • Own the experience after someone signs up: onboarding, activation, education, re-engagement and appropriate routes into a commercial conversation
  • Plan, write and operate newsletters for relevant audience segments
  • Build a distinctive, reliable social presence and adapt strong ideas intelligently across formats
  • Own the blog calendar and personally write, commission or edit technical explainers, points of view, customer stories, product announcements and use-case content
  • Interview researchers, engineers, customers and partners and turn their knowledge into accurate, compelling material
  • Research search demand and competitive results, identify areas where HASH can earn authority, and create high-quality SEO briefs and content clusters
  • Improve website and landing-page copy, calls to action and conversion paths
  • Build and maintain marketing automation, segmentation, lead scoring, instrumentation and reporting
  • Create useful sales-enablement material and keep it current
  • Brief and prioritize the Senior Brand Designer’s work across posts, email, campaigns, decks, reports and case studies
  • Measure activation, qualified audience growth, organic discovery, inbound demand and sales influence, and change the programme when the evidence warrants it

Why HASH

  • Work with substantive material spanning open source, enterprise deployments and frontier AI research
  • Shape how a differentiated company and emerging category are understood
  • Build the marketing and communications function with direct access to the founder and technical team
  • Join at a moment of rapid growth, with outsized scope and influence
  • Be part of a high-agency team that cares about output, ownership and quality
  • We've raised $5.5m+ from Silicon Valley VCs, and have contracted >$10m in revenue in the last 18 months. Our founding team have established and sold companies for tens of millions, hundreds of millions, and billions of dollars (including household names like Trello and Stack Overflow)

This role is probably not for you if

  • Your experience is limited to operating mature functions with established teams and processes
  • You want to oversee marketing but do not want to get your hands dirty personally
  • You prefer consensus to making a timely decision
  • You want a narrow remit with predictable boundaries
  • You are not interested in understanding a deeply technical product
  • You simply want to scale an existing process, rather than develop, execute and iterate on strategy from the ground-up
  • You're looking for a traditional 9-5 comms or marketing job

Benefits

A base salary will be offered of £90,000-120,000 in London.

Compensation in this role is extremely heavily performance-based, with generous equity/bonus offered in addition to the base salary, in order to align sales incentives.
